International Master Games in Sri Lanka
AGSEP is organising International Master Games in Sri Lanka where Competitors from 30 countries will take part from September to November, 2011.
Players between the ages of 30 to 70 years will take part in table tennis, badminton, football, handball and beach soccer tournaments which will be played in towns such as Negombo, Kandy, Trincomalee, Galle, Marawila, Puttalam and Hambantota.
Teams from Germany, France, Italy, Norway, Netherlands, Belgium, Luxembourg, England, Austria, Switzerland, Sweden, Scotland, Finland, Denmark, Poland, Russia, Ireland and Asian countries Japan, China, Malaysia, India, Pakistan, Maldives, Taiwan, Sri Lanka, Hong Kong, Singapore, Indonesia, South Korea and Vietnam will compete in the Masters Games.
